#e1518e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e1518e is composed of 88.2% red, 31.8%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 64% magenta, 36.9%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 334.6 degrees, a saturation of 70.6% and a lightness of 60%. #e1518e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a2ff with #c3001d.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

#e1518e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e1518e has RGB values of R:225, G:81, B:142 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.64, Y:0.37,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 14766478.

Shades and Tints of #e1518e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0205 is the darkest color, while #fef8f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#e1518e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9a9899 is the less saturated color, while #f9398a is the most saturated one.
